Dodging Compliance Errors with a Trusty Transaction Coordinator by Your Side

Handling real estate transactions in Florida requires attention to detail and knowledge of regulations. For real estate agents focused on growing their business, these tasks can be overwhelming. A reliable Transaction Coordinator (TC) can manage these crucial elements, allowing agents to concentrate on closing more deals. Below, explore the top three mistakes a TC helps agents avoid, ensuring a smooth transaction from contract to close.


Problem 1: Mismanagement of Deadlines

In Florida's busy real estate market, managing multiple transactions can be demanding. Important deadlines, like inspection periods, loan approvals, and closing dates, can easily be overlooked. Missing these deadlines could lead to losing a deal, legal issues, or dissatisfied clients. Solution

A Transaction Coordinator monitors and manages all deadlines, ensuring compliance with every contract requirement. With their support, agents can remain organized and confident that critical steps are handled promptly. Transaction Coordinators create a timeline for each transaction, keeping everyone informed, and preventing any drop in client confidence.


Problem 2: Incomplete Documents and Compliance Issues

Real estate transactions involve a considerable amount of paperwork. Contracts, addendums, and disclosures must be accurate and complete. Errors or omissions can result in serious compliance issues with Florida regulations or even lead to a failed transaction. The complexity of these documents often increases with ongoing regulation changes and market adjustments.

Solution

Transaction Coordinators review and manage all documentation, ensuring nothing is overlooked. They stay updated on the latest changes in real estate regulations, so every required form is included and accurately completed. By reducing the risk of compliance errors, agents can safeguard their transactions, maintain their license, and enhance their reliability.


Problem 3: Poor Communication and Client Experience

Effective communication is crucial to a successful real estate transaction. Agents must keep clients informed, manage expectations, and address concerns promptly. In a fast-paced environment like Florida, neglecting communication can lead to client frustration and lost opportunities.

Solution

Transaction Coordinators serve as a communication bridge, providing updates and answering questions from clients and other parties involved. They ensure that everyone is on the same page and aware of progress or changes. Agents can focus on nurturing relationships and expanding their network, knowing their clients are well-informed and satisfied.


Additional Benefits of a Transaction Coordinator

While avoiding major mistakes, a Transaction Coordinator streamlines many aspects of the real estate process. Here’s how a TC further enhances agent productivity and client satisfaction:

  • Flexibility: TCs handle a variety of transaction types, from residential to commercial deals, adapting to the specific needs of each.
  • Technology Savvy: TCs utilize advanced software, keeping track of transactions digitally, allowing agents and clients access to reports and status updates online.
  • Cost Efficiency: By preventing errors and saving time, TCs ultimately contribute to better resource management, potentially increasing profit margins.
